tonsil

5 senses ·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. n. One of the two glandular organs situated in the throat at the sides of the fauces. The tonsils are sometimes called the almonds, from their shape. Source: opted
  2. 2. n. either of two masses of lymphatic tissue one on each side of the oral pharynx Source: wordnet
